ENGINE DETAIL

The CaseIH C90 tractor features a robust Perkins 1004.40T turbocharged engine with a displacement of 4.0L, providing a gross output of 90hp at a rated RPM of 2200, ideal for moderate agricultural tasks. With a maximum torque of 264 lb-ft at 1400 RPM, it excels in applications requiring immediate power delivery for tasks like plowing or heavy towing. Its mechanical direct injection system and dual air cleaner help maintain fuel efficiency and engine longevity, although scheduled oil changes every 250 hours may require diligent maintenance planning.

Description Perkins 1004.40T turbocharged diesel 4-cylinder liquid-cooled
Displacement 243.5ci / 4.0L
Bore/Stroke 3.93x5.00inches / 100x 127mm
Power (gross) 90hp / 67.1kW
Fuel system mechanical direct injection with 5-hole injectors
Air cleaner dual paper elements
Compression 17.25:1
Rated RPM 2200
Torque 264lb-ft / 358.0Nm
Torque RPM 1400
Starter volts 12
Oil capacity 9.3qts / 8.8L
Oil change 250 h
Coolant capacity 16.9qts / 16.0L

C90 SERIAL NUMBERS

Location Near the tractor steering column on right side
1998 JJE1000056
1999 JJE1008492
2000 JJE1013490
2001 JJE1017672
2002 JJE1019985
